Hughson's police chief summarized the department’s 2025 annual report, noting about 3,500 calls for service with 49% self-initiated activity, 81 adult arrests, increases in traffic collisions, and plans to expand training and community policing partnerships.

Hughson’s police chief presented an annual report at the Feb. 23 council meeting highlighting deployment, community engagement and statistics for 2025.
